Inspired by the untamed beauty of forests, these yards were as soon as regarded as symbols of wide range and status. Woodland landscapes continue to be a popular selection amongst property owners looking for to produce a serene and natural place in their yard. One defining aspect of these landscapes is the unification of native plants, which have effectively adapted to the neighborhood climate and dirt conditions.




By embracing indigenous plants, timberland gardens require much less water, fertilizer, and pesticides, making them a much more lasting and environmentally-friendly option. Digital Photography by Garrett Cook Desert yards, likewise known as xeriscaping or dry landscaping, grow in completely dry and drought-prone regions. These yards showcase plants that have actually grown familiar with the hot and dry conditions, making them low-maintenance and water-efficient.


They are normally utilized to the local environment, soil problems, and wild animals, making them a lot more durable and much better fit to prosper in their atmosphere. This design style accepts the beauty of neighborhood flora and animals, promoting a feeling of place and linking us to the land we live on. Picture: Christopher Lee Mediterranean yards came from in the nations surrounding the Mediterranean Sea, such as Italy, Greece, and Spain, where the environment is hot and dry.


In a Mediterranean environment, the summertime warmth and aridity are considerable obstacles for plant growth. To resolve this, Mediterranean garden style incorporates aspects that give shade, such as pergolas and arbors, to shield plants from direct sunshine throughout the hottest hours of the day. These frameworks serve a practical purpose yet also add building interest to the garden.

Official gardens are usually connected with grand estates and palaces, where whatever is perfectly in proportion and in line. These gardens follow a strict geometric pattern, with straight lines and appropriate angles dominating the design.


The use of hardscaping elements such as water fountains, sculptures, and paths is likewise common in official gardens. Informal yards have a tendency to have curved paths, irregularly designed flower beds, and a mix of various plant types.

You can create a visually pleasing landscape by following these six concepts of layout. There are 6 principles of style that have been utilized by artists for centuries throughout all art forms, painting and floral design in addition to landscape layout. They are: Equilibrium Focalization Simplicity Rhythm and Line Percentage Unity Balance is a state of being in addition to seeing.


There are 2 major kinds of balance: in proportion and asymmetrical. In proportion balance is utilized in formal landscapes when one side of the landscape is a mirror photo of the contrary side. These landscapes usually utilize geometric patterns in the walkways, planting beds and also how the plants are pruned right into shapes.
